The Use Of Motion Detectors In Modern Homes

The use of motion detector technology in the home and also in restaurants has progressively been on the rise in previous couple of years as these systems contribute to a sanitary environment. The problem with the majority Kitchen Trash Can is that you need to touch the lids in order to open them. As you know, germs are rapidly moved between people simply by touching common objects similar to this. This is exactly one of the reasons why you must purchase an automatic Kitchen Trash Can for your house since these open for you when garbage is noticed in range.

As soon as motion is no longer detected, the lid automatically shuts to prohibit trash from making your home smell. This is quite advantageous for numerous reasons as these trash cans can help to avoid the spread of germs.

 

These motion detectors come with a microchip in them that will regulate the device for slow and methodical temperature modifications. This way when your room warms up and cools down during an armed Motion Detector Alarm occasion, you not have to worry about receiving a false alarm.

Some motion detectors are designed to be mounted in the ceiling and span a 360-degree cone outwards. Some are set into the wall to duplicate an electric outlet, and various other features are obtainable for the James Bond like clients. Generally, the device is an aesthetically pleasing small system that is mounted 5-7 feet high in the corner of your room.
